Phase transfer switch
What is everybody using for their inverter to feed 30 amps into the 50 amp panel?
I hear the AM solar SPS smart phase selector is not being sold.
Any help would be appreciated.

Don't understand the question. The newer RV's have a 50 amp TS. If equipped with an inverter, the inverter has a built in TS that passes shore or gen power when present. If not present it starts to invert. It has a built in 20 amp breaker and directly feeds designated outlets. No connection to the panel. The TS switches between the gen and shore power. Progressive Dynamics is popular but there are several to choose from.

Your question is not clear.
Are you talking about an inverter to convert 12 vdc battery power to 120 vac? (That would take over 300 amps of 12 vdc to create 30 amps of 120 vac).
Or are you talking about an inverter generator to supply 30 amps of 120 vac?

I think there's a 'terminology' issue.
RV power is Single Phase.
Your choices are 30A single phase or 50A single phase (2 legs 110V same circuit.) Your RV decides what to do from there.

I think I understand, Charlie. You want to feed both 50a legs of your coach when on a 30a connection. I actually have the Smart Phase Selector - I wasn’t aware they quit selling it. It works great for me. Victron now makes an inverter with a built in 50a transfer switch, so maybe that’s an option?
